What is a master alarm code?

The Master Code is the principal alarm system code. The Master Code offers access to a user menu in addition to arming and disarming the alarm system.

What happens if my ADT alarm sounds?

When the ADT alarm is triggered, the ADT monitoring station calls the home or business owner at 1-2 phone numbers and then alerts the authorities if they do not get a response with the right password for the account.

What is the code for installing?

Installer Code (also known as Program Code or Dealer Code, depending on manufacturer) is a specific code used to access system configuration settings, allowing a user to add sensors/zones, adjust delay times, edit central station telephone numbers, and update account information.

What is the difference between user code and master code?

What is the difference between a Master Code and a User Code? A master code differs from a typical user code in that it may alter itself and can add, amend, or remove normal user codes.
